# Break-Glass: Catalog Cache Invalidation

Scope: the Pinrow product catalog at Veldstone Retail. If stale prices persist after a purge and the Hollowmere invalidation queue is wedged, use break-glass to flush the edge tier directly. Contractors: get verbal sign-off from the catalog lead first. Steps: open the Hollowmere admin shell, select emergency-flush, confirm the tenant, and run it once — repeated flushes thrash the origin. Access is logged and expires after 20 minutes. Unseal the admin shell with the passphrase below.

recovery phrase for kahop-tajog: istix-casvan

Ticket: Staging env misconfigured for Siftgate bloom filter

The bloom layer in front of the Pellet KV store is rejecting all lookups in staging because the env file was copied from the dev template without credentials. False-positive tuning values are fine; only the auth line is missing. To unblock the weekly demo, the Pellet admission secret must be set on the following line.

env line for yaguf-fajop: LEDGER_TOKEN13=fb08984397349

Runbook: Ostrel cluster intermittently fails DNS resolution for internal service names. Check resolver cache health first; restart the sidecar if hit rate drops below 90%. Failures are timeout-based, not NXDOMAIN — no spoofing indicators observed. Escalate only if errors persist after cache flush. Attach the trace token below to any escalation.

build token for kagaf-hahof: htk14_9d3d4d26d7d8de